What Advanced Security Features Define the Best Lightweight Business Laptops in 2025?
In an era where data breaches and cyber threats are increasingly sophisticated, selecting a business laptop with robust security features is no longer optional—it’s essential. As I’ve explored the latest offerings, I’ve found that top-tier models integrate a suite of advanced security measures that cater to the needs of modern professionals.
One standout feature is **Trusted Platform Module (TPM)** integration, which provides hardware-based encryption, ensuring that your data remains protected even if the device falls into the wrong hands. Coupled with biometric authentication—such as fingerprint scanners and facial recognition—these features create a formidable barrier against unauthorized access. For example, models available in the top business laptops with security combine these elements seamlessly.
Another critical security enhancement is **secure BIOS** and firmware protection, which prevent malicious actors from tampering with the system at a fundamental level. Hardware encryption, especially when integrated with hardware security modules, ensures that sensitive information remains encrypted both at rest and during transmission. These features are particularly vital for professionals handling confidential client data, legal documents, or proprietary business information.
Moreover, the integration of physical security measures such as **privacy screens** and **anti-theft locks** can complement digital safeguards, providing a holistic security approach. Privacy screens prevent visual hacking in public spaces, while anti-theft locks deter physical theft, especially when working in cafes or airports.
It’s worth noting that security isn’t just about hardware; software also plays a crucial role. Modern security suites include **endpoint protection**, regular firmware updates, and secure authentication protocols, all designed to create a layered defense system. The Critical Role of Secure Boot and Firmware Integrity in Modern Business Devices
In my experience, secure boot processes and firmware integrity checks are vital components that often go unnoticed but are crucial for maintaining a resilient security posture. These features ensure that only verified, signed firmware and BIOS are loaded during startup, preventing malicious tampering. I recall a scenario where a device with compromised firmware was exploited, underlining the importance of these protections. Integrating secure boot with hardware root of trust mechanisms, as detailed in recent CSO article, fortifies the device at a fundamental level, making it resistant to low-level attacks.
How Do Hardware Security Modules (HSMs) Elevate Data Protection in Portable Devices?
Hardware Security Modules (HSMs) embedded within ultrabooks provide a dedicated environment for generating, storing, and managing cryptographic keys. This dedicated hardware not only enhances performance but also isolates keys from the main system, significantly reducing exposure to malware and physical extraction attempts. In my practice, deploying devices with embedded HSMs has demonstrated a marked improvement in compliance with strict data protection regulations, like GDPR, enabling secure handling of client data even in volatile environments.
